Regular Season Round 127: San Antonio S. - LA Lakers 83-99
Date: March 6, 2011
Kobe Bryant agreed it might have been the Lakers' best game so far. It technically wasn't the worst for the San Antonio Spurs, though it often looked that way. The Lakers may not catch the NBA's winningest team for the No. 1 seed in time for the playoffs, but they handed the Spurs a blunt reminder that the Western Conference is still theirs to surrender, beating San Antonio 99-83 in a blowout Sunday. Bryant, who finished with 26 points, didn't make much of it. ``I don't think it's that big of a message that we sent today,' he said. It was the seventh straight victory for the Lakers, who are playing as well as any point this season. Coach Phil Jackson concedes that San Antonio's 6 1/2-game lead in the West may be too big to overcome with 18 games left. But the Lakers still made a few marks. One is emphatically ending San Antonio's franchise-record home winning streak at 22 games. Another is beating the Spurs for the first time in three tries, including last month's stunning loss in Los Angeles when Antonio McDyess tipped in the game-winner at the buzzer. *Courtesy of www.comcast.net
